In CS 1.6, the Deagle's accuracy is heavily influenced by your frame rate ( fps_max ), your network settings ( ex_interp ), and how the engine handles mouse input. A default config often leaves the recoil feeling "floaty." An exclusive aim CFG tweaks these hidden variables to ensure that when your crosshair is on a head, the bullet actually lands there. Even the best exclusive CFG won't help if you "spam" the fire button. In CS 1.6, the Deagle requires a rhythmic pause between shots. Use your new CFG to practice : tapping the opposite movement key to come to a dead stop before clicking. With these settings, that stop-and-shoot motion will feel significantly snappier.
